SUMMARY

The Georgia Civic Awareness Program for Students (GCAPS) was developed by the Association of County Commissioners of Georgia (ACCG) to address the need for increased civic involvement and awareness among the state’s youth and engage them to become the next generation of civic leaders. The program is dedicated to educating young citizens about the importance of being actively conscious of their local government environment and the opportunities available in the public sector. GCAPS provides civic education by exposing youth to the role that local government plays and by introducing them to the leaders who make local governments work.

GCAPS is designed to provide students with the opportunity to learn first-hand the roles and services that Macon-Bibb County government provides. Throughout the course of the program year, GCAPS participants will take part in team building exercises, attend a board of commissioners meeting, tour county facilities, visit the State Capitol and interact with local and state elected officials. Students will be asked to choose a class project to benefit Macon-Bibb County.

GCAPS is fully supported by the Macon-Bibb County Board of Commissioners.

PROGRAM DETAILS

  • Student Participants (Who is Eligible?):
    • Must be a 10th, 11th or 12th grade student as of August 2024
    • All students who either live in Macon-Bibb County or attend school in Macon-Bibb County will be eligible to participate
  • Time Commitment:
    • Program consists of 10 sessions from September 2024 through April 2025
    • Monthly meetings, which will be held after school with two excused absences from school
    • Please review the meeting schedule to ensure you will be able to make all meetings.
    • Must provide your own transportation to the sessions.
